Each channel amplifier of the ZG-421 series is pre-tuned to a desired channel by the manufacturer - making an order it is necessary to give the channel number.
Channel amplifiers of the ZG-421 series are top class devices designed for filtering and amplifying TV signals in the UHF band (470-862 MHz). They can process both analog and digital signals DVB-T). The output signals can be distributed in large shared antenna systems (MATV/SMATV) - in multi-dwelling units, hotels, public buildings etc.
The great advantage of the ZG-421 series is high selectivity, consisting in capability of filtering the desired signal from among the variety of signals on the input. Attenuation of undesirable signals on the neighboring channels (N+1, N-1) equals 17 dB, and on the N+2 and N-2 channels is 56 dB.
The ZG-421 amplifiers can be used together with the older ZG-401 ones.
Frequency characteristics of the ZG-401 (blue) and ZG-421 (red) channel amplifiers.
It is clear that the selectivity of the ZG-421 series is much better.

Specifications
Name | ZG-421 |
Code | R90517P |
Channels | 51-55 |
Gain [dB] | 53 |
Bandwidth [MHz] | 8 |
Gain adjustment range [dB] | 20 |
Max level of output signal (DIN 45004K) [dBμV] | 2x120 |
Selectivity (N+1 or N-1 channel) [dB] | 17 |
Selectivity (N+2 or N-2 channel) [dB] | 56 |
Noise figure [dB] | 3.5 |
Connectors [mm] | IEC 9.5 |
Power [V/mA] | +24/75 |
Weight (single module) [kg] | 0.40 |
Operating temperature [°C] | -10...+65 |
IP rating | IP20 |
Dimensions (height x depth x width) [mm] | 196x76x32 |
